GNU/Linux >> LINUX-Kenntnisse >  >> Linux

python linux selenium:chrome nicht erreichbar

Das Hinzufügen einiger Chrome-Optionen hat geholfen!

chrome_options = webdriver.ChromeOptions()
chrome_options.add_argument('--no-sandbox')
chrome = webdriver.Chrome('/usr/local/bin/chromedriver', chrome_options=chrome_options)

Wenn Sie Docker verwenden und diesen Fehler erhalten, habe ich die Lösung!

Die Ursache des Problems ist, dass Chrome nicht genügend Arbeitsspeicher hat, wie hier dokumentiert.

Sie müssen das Flag "--shm-size=2g" zum Docker-Run-Befehl hinzufügen.


Linux
  1. Systemweiter Mutex in Python unter Linux

  2. So führen Sie eine Python-Datei unter Linux aus

  3. Entschlüsseln Sie Chrome Linux BLOB-verschlüsselte Cookies in Python

  4. Linux-limits.conf funktioniert nicht?

  5. Python-Module wurden nicht über das Terminal gefunden, sondern auf der Python-Shell, Linux

Installieren Sie Python 3 auf Redhat 8

So installieren Sie Google Chrome unter Linux Mint 20 / Linux Mint 19

bpython – Ein schicker Python-Interpreter für Linux

So installieren Sie Dash Framework in Python unter Linux

So installieren Sie die PyBrain-Python-Bibliothek unter Linux

Der Linux-Befehl „ll“ funktioniert nicht